Five Whys

The Five Whys is a classic technique to find the root cause of a problem. By repeatedly asking "why," you'll drill down from symptoms to the core issue. It's simple but surprisingly effective.

Step-by-Step Instructions


  1. Start with a clear problem statement.

  2. Ask "Why does this problem occur?" and write down the answer.

  3. Use that answer as the basis for your next "Why?"

  4. Repeat this process, typically five times, until you reach the root cause. You might need fewer or more "whys".

  5. The final answer should reveal the fundamental issue.

  6. Document each level of "why," as each may offer intervention opportunities.

Facilitator Tips

Five is just a guideline. Sometimes you need fewer or more "whys." Watch out for circular reasoning or stopping at symptoms, not causes. I've found it useful to create actions for issues at every level, not just the root cause. Sometimes the team gets stuck - don't be afraid to rephrase the question or take a different angle.
